Transaction 3ec076c63b56edef7b6dd708331e093fbdba13cffd49cd23b50c0e51c40f5315

2 Input
2 Outputs
  • 3ec076c63b56edef7b6dd708331e093fbdba13cffd49cd23b50c0e51c40f5315:0
  • value  426285
    address  3PYxtDt5BbTDWAaeL4L9PBaosZNJqinTEs
  • 3ec076c63b56edef7b6dd708331e093fbdba13cffd49cd23b50c0e51c40f5315:1
  • value  3580696
    address  13KDZhHYsrnoCp5Fwu3KLTxfC2Po34MpCR